In mid-December before all the rain, we spent a week in Mendocino and Fort Bragg. We always visit the Mendocino Coast Botanical Garden in Fort Bragg. Whatever the season, there are always so many plants and trees blooming, and extraordinary landscape to enjoy. We strolled around, and found the heaths and heathers, some rhodies still flowering, numerous mushrooms and fungi growing, with quite a selection displayed on a table. My favorite plant was the deep ruby-red smoke bush. I think that one needs at least 3 hours to properly wander around and appreciate these spectacular gardens by the sea. Not to be missed is walking out to the bluffs and sitting on a bench facing the majestic Pacific ocean. Such a special place.
